A1 Idiom محايد

笨手笨脚

ben shou ben jiao

Clumsy; awkward

المعنى

Describes someone who is awkward in movement or prone to dropping things.

🌍

خلفية ثقافية

Commonly used in family settings to tease children who drop things. Used similarly, often with a softer tone. Often used in Cantonese-influenced Mandarin. Used in daily colloquial Mandarin.

💡

Self-Deprecation

Use this to make people laugh when you make a mistake. It shows you don't take yourself too seriously.
